* [ovmf test] 87014: regressions - FAIL
@ 2016-03-23 15:27 osstest service owner
2016-03-24 0:21 ` Jim Fehlig
0 siblings, 1 reply; 4+ messages in thread
From: osstest service owner @ 2016-03-23 15:27 UTC (permalink / raw)
To: xen-devel, osstest-admin
[-- Attachment #1: Type: text/plain, Size: 5500 bytes --]
flight 87014 ovmf real [real]
http://logs.test-lab.xenproject.org/osstest/logs/87014/
Regressions :-(
Tests which did not succeed and are blocking,
including tests which could not be run:
test-amd64-amd64-xl-qemuu-ovmf-amd64 9 debian-hvm-install fail REGR. vs. 65543
test-amd64-i386-xl-qemuu-ovmf-amd64 9 debian-hvm-install fail REGR. vs. 65543
version targeted for testing:
ovmf 6a9bc80154dd8771bc6f76b9b6c7579753e86e50
baseline version:
ovmf 5ac96e3a28dd26eabee421919f67fa7c443a47f1
Last test of basis 65543 2015-12-08 08:45:15 Z 106 days
Failing since 65593 2015-12-08 23:44:51 Z 105 days 117 attempts
Testing same since 87014 2016-03-23 07:35:56 Z 0 days 1 attempts
------------------------------------------------------------
People who touched revisions under test:
"Samer El-Haj-Mahmoud" <elhaj@hpe.com>
"Wu, Hao A" <hao.a.wu@intel.com>
"Yao, Jiewen" <jiewen.yao@intel.com>
Alcantara, Paulo <paulo.alc.cavalcanti@hp.com>
Anbazhagan Baraneedharan <anbazhagan@hp.com>
Andrew Fish <afish@apple.com>
Ard Biesheuvel <ard.biesheuvel@linaro.org>
Arthur Crippa Burigo <acb@hp.com>
Cecil Sheng <cecil.sheng@hpe.com>
Chao Zhang <chao.b.zhang@intel.com>
Chao Zhang<chao.b.zhang@intel.com>
Charles Duffy <chaduffy@cisco.com>
Cinnamon Shia <cinnamon.shia@hpe.com>
Cohen, Eugene <eugene@hp.com>
Dandan Bi <dandan.bi@intel.com>
Daocheng Bu <daocheng.bu@intel.com>
Daryl McDaniel <edk2-lists@mc2research.org>
David Woodhouse <David.Woodhouse@intel.com>
Derek Lin <derek.lin2@hpe.com>
edk2 dev <edk2.dev@edk2.org>
edk2-devel <edk2-devel-bounces@lists.01.org>
Eric Dong <eirc.dong@intel.com>
Eric Dong <eric.dong@intel.com>
Eugene Cohen <eugene@hp.com>
Evan Lloyd <evan.lloyd@arm.com>
Feng Tian <feng.tian@intel.com>
Fu Siyuan <siyuan.fu@intel.com>
Gabriel Somlo <somlo@cmu.edu>
Gary Ching-Pang Lin <glin@suse.com>
Gary Lin <glin@suse.com>
Ghazi Belaam <Ghazi.belaam@hpe.com>
Hao Wu <hao.a.wu@intel.com>
Haojian Zhuang <haojian.zhuang@linaro.org>
Hess Chen <hesheng.chen@intel.com>
Heyi Guo <heyi.guo@linaro.org>
Jaben Carsey <jaben.carsey@intel.com>
Jeff Fan <jeff.fan@intel.com>
Jiaxin Wu <jiaxin.wu@intel.com>
jiewen yao <jiewen.yao@intel.com>
Jim Dailey <jim_dailey@dell.com>
Jim_Dailey@Dell.com <Jim_Dailey@Dell.com>
Jordan Justen <jordan.l.justen@intel.com>
Karyne Mayer <kmayer@hp.com>
Larry Hauch <larry.hauch@intel.com>
Laszlo Ersek <lersek@redhat.com>
Leahy, Leroy P
Leahy, Leroy P <leroy.p.leahy@intel.com>
Lee Leahy <leroy.p.leahy@intel.com>
Leekha Shaveta <shaveta@freescale.com>
Leif Lindholm <leif.lindholm@linaro.org>
Liming Gao <liming.gao@intel.com>
Mark Rutland <mark.rutland@arm.com>
Marvin Haeuser <Marvin.Haeuser@outlook.com>
Michael Kinney <michael.d.kinney@intel.com>
Michael LeMay <michael.lemay@intel.com>
Michael Thomas <malinka@entropy-development.com>
MichaÅ Zegan <webczat_200@poczta.onet.pl>
Ni, Ruiyu <C:/Program Files (x86)/Git/O=Intel/OU=Pacifica02/cn=Recipients/cn=rni2>
Paolo Bonzini <pbonzini@redhat.com>
Paulo Alcantara <paulo.alc.cavalcanti@hp.com>
Paulo Alcantara Cavalcanti <paulo.alc.cavalcanti@hp.com>
Peter Kirmeier <topeterk@freenet.de>
Qin Long <qin.long@intel.com>
Qiu Shumin <shumin.qiu@intel.com>
Rodrigo Dias Correa <rodrigo.dia.correa@hp.com>
Ruiyu Ni <ruiyu.ni@intel.com>
Ryan Harkin <ryan.harkin@linaro.org>
Samer El-Haj-Mahmoud <elhaj@hpe.com>
Samer El-Haj-Mahmoud <samer.el-haj-mahmoud@hpe.com>
Star Zeng <star.zeng@intel.com>
Supreeth Venkatesh <supreeth.venkatesh@arm.com>
Tapan Shah <tapandshah@hpe.com>
Tian, Feng <feng.tian@intel.com>
Vladislav Vovchenko <vladislav.vovchenko@sk.com>
Yao Jiewen <Jiewen.Yao@intel.com>
Yao, Jiewen <jiewen.yao@intel.com>
Ye Ting <ting.ye@intel.com>
Yonghong Zhu <yonghong.zhu@intel.com>
Zhang Lubo <lubo.zhang@intel.com>
Zhang, Chao B <chao.b.zhang@intel.com>
Zhang, Lubo <C:/Program Files (x86)/Git/o=Intel/ou=Exchange Administrative Group (FYDIBOHF23SPDLT)/cn=Recipients/cn=Zhang, Lubob8d>
Zhangfei Gao <zhangfei.gao@linaro.org>
jobs:
build-amd64-xsm pass
build-i386-xsm pass
build-amd64 pass
build-i386 pass
build-amd64-libvirt pass
build-i386-libvirt pass
build-amd64-pvops pass
build-i386-pvops pass
test-amd64-amd64-xl-qemuu-ovmf-amd64 fail
test-amd64-i386-xl-qemuu-ovmf-amd64 fail
------------------------------------------------------------
sg-report-flight on osstest.test-lab.xenproject.org
logs: /home/logs/logs
images: /home/logs/images
Logs, config files, etc. are available at
http://logs.test-lab.xenproject.org/osstest/logs
Explanation of these reports, and of osstest in general, is at
http://xenbits.xen.org/gitweb/?p=osstest.git;a=blob;f=README.email;hb=master
http://xenbits.xen.org/gitweb/?p=osstest.git;a=blob;f=README;hb=master
Test harness code can be found at
http://xenbits.xen.org/gitweb?p=osstest.git;a=summary
Not pushing.
(No revision log; it would be 13970 lines long.)
[-- Attachment #2: Type: text/plain, Size: 126 bytes --]
_______________________________________________
Xen-devel mailing list
Xen-devel@lists.xen.org
http://lists.xen.org/xen-devel
^ permalink raw reply [flat|nested] 4+ messages in thread
* Re: [ovmf test] 87014: regressions - FAIL
2016-03-23 15:27 [ovmf test] 87014: regressions - FAIL osstest service owner
@ 2016-03-24 0:21 ` Jim Fehlig
2016-03-24 14:12 ` Wei Liu
0 siblings, 1 reply; 4+ messages in thread
From: Jim Fehlig @ 2016-03-24 0:21 UTC (permalink / raw)
To: osstest service owner, xen-devel; +Cc: Anthony Perard, Wei Liu
On 03/23/2016 09:27 AM, osstest service owner wrote:
> flight 87014 ovmf real [real]
> http://logs.test-lab.xenproject.org/osstest/logs/87014/
>
> Regressions :-(
>
> Tests which did not succeed and are blocking,
> including tests which could not be run:
> test-amd64-amd64-xl-qemuu-ovmf-amd64 9 debian-hvm-install fail REGR. vs. 65543
> test-amd64-i386-xl-qemuu-ovmf-amd64 9 debian-hvm-install fail REGR. vs. 65543
I've been testing Anthony's series to 'Load BIOS via toolstack instead of been
embedded in hvmloader' [0] in an attempt to use the distro ovmf instead of
"ovmf-xen". openSUSE Factory's ovmf package [1] is updated regularly with an
upstream git snapshot and I noticed VMs did not boot when using it. I bisected
and found ovmf commit 7b0a1ead the culprit
commit 7b0a1ead7d2efa7f9eae4c2b254ff154d9c5f74f
Author: Ruiyu Ni <ruiyu.ni@intel.com>
Date: Wed Feb 17 18:06:36 2016 +0800
MdeModuelPkg/PciBus: Return AddrTranslationOffset in GetBarAttributes
Some platform doesn't use CPU(HOST)/Device 1:1 mapping for PCI Bus.
But PCI IO doesn't have interface to tell caller (device driver)
whether the address returned by GetBarAttributes() is HOST address
or device address.
UEFI Spec 2.6 addresses this issue by clarifying the address returned
is HOST address and caller can use AddrTranslationOffset to calculate
the device address.
I'm sure it's biting this test too.
BTW, any pointers on getting debug info from
hvmloader+ovmf+qemu+other-components-involved? With the broken ovmf, I got
nothing on the VM serial port, an empty, black vfb, nothing beyond "Invoking
OVMF..." in xl dmesg, and no errors in the qemu log file. Beyond bisecting, I
wasn't sure how to debug :-). I tried adding
device_model_args=[ "-debugcon file:debug.log", "-global isa-debugcon.iobase=0x402"]
to the VM config, but qemu failed to start with "-debugcon file:debug.log:
invalid option"
Regards,
Jim
[0] http://lists.xenproject.org/archives/html/xen-devel/2016-03/msg01626.html
[1] https://build.opensuse.org/package/show/Virtualization/ovmf
_______________________________________________
Xen-devel mailing list
Xen-devel@lists.xen.org
http://lists.xen.org/xen-devel
^ permalink raw reply [flat|nested] 4+ messages in thread
* Re: [ovmf test] 87014: regressions - FAIL
2016-03-24 0:21 ` Jim Fehlig
@ 2016-03-24 14:12 ` Wei Liu
2016-03-24 16:38 ` Jim Fehlig
0 siblings, 1 reply; 4+ messages in thread
From: Wei Liu @ 2016-03-24 14:12 UTC (permalink / raw)
To: Jim Fehlig; +Cc: Anthony Perard, xen-devel, Wei Liu, osstest service owner
On Wed, Mar 23, 2016 at 06:21:58PM -0600, Jim Fehlig wrote:
> On 03/23/2016 09:27 AM, osstest service owner wrote:
> > flight 87014 ovmf real [real]
> > http://logs.test-lab.xenproject.org/osstest/logs/87014/
> >
> > Regressions :-(
> >
> > Tests which did not succeed and are blocking,
> > including tests which could not be run:
> > test-amd64-amd64-xl-qemuu-ovmf-amd64 9 debian-hvm-install fail REGR. vs. 65543
> > test-amd64-i386-xl-qemuu-ovmf-amd64 9 debian-hvm-install fail REGR. vs. 65543
>
> I've been testing Anthony's series to 'Load BIOS via toolstack instead of been
> embedded in hvmloader' [0] in an attempt to use the distro ovmf instead of
> "ovmf-xen". openSUSE Factory's ovmf package [1] is updated regularly with an
> upstream git snapshot and I noticed VMs did not boot when using it. I bisected
> and found ovmf commit 7b0a1ead the culprit
>
> commit 7b0a1ead7d2efa7f9eae4c2b254ff154d9c5f74f
> Author: Ruiyu Ni <ruiyu.ni@intel.com>
> Date: Wed Feb 17 18:06:36 2016 +0800
>
> MdeModuelPkg/PciBus: Return AddrTranslationOffset in GetBarAttributes
>
> Some platform doesn't use CPU(HOST)/Device 1:1 mapping for PCI Bus.
> But PCI IO doesn't have interface to tell caller (device driver)
> whether the address returned by GetBarAttributes() is HOST address
> or device address.
> UEFI Spec 2.6 addresses this issue by clarifying the address returned
> is HOST address and caller can use AddrTranslationOffset to calculate
> the device address.
>
> I'm sure it's biting this test too.
Yes, and OSSTest already fingered that commit. According to Anthony OVMF
is even more broken now because more bugs crept in.
Anthony is working on fixing OVMF.
>
> BTW, any pointers on getting debug info from
> hvmloader+ovmf+qemu+other-components-involved? With the broken ovmf, I got
> nothing on the VM serial port, an empty, black vfb, nothing beyond "Invoking
> OVMF..." in xl dmesg, and no errors in the qemu log file. Beyond bisecting, I
> wasn't sure how to debug :-). I tried adding
>
> device_model_args=[ "-debugcon file:debug.log", "-global isa-debugcon.iobase=0x402"]
>
Can you try
device_model_args = ["-debugcon", "file:debug.log", "-global", "isa-debugcon.iobase=0x402"]
?
Wei.
> to the VM config, but qemu failed to start with "-debugcon file:debug.log:
> invalid option"
>
> Regards,
> Jim
>
> [0] http://lists.xenproject.org/archives/html/xen-devel/2016-03/msg01626.html
> [1] https://build.opensuse.org/package/show/Virtualization/ovmf
>
_______________________________________________
Xen-devel mailing list
Xen-devel@lists.xen.org
http://lists.xen.org/xen-devel
^ permalink raw reply [flat|nested] 4+ messages in thread
* Re: [ovmf test] 87014: regressions - FAIL
2016-03-24 14:12 ` Wei Liu
@ 2016-03-24 16:38 ` Jim Fehlig
0 siblings, 0 replies; 4+ messages in thread
From: Jim Fehlig @ 2016-03-24 16:38 UTC (permalink / raw)
To: Wei Liu; +Cc: Anthony Perard, xen-devel, osstest service owner
Wei Liu wrote:
> On Wed, Mar 23, 2016 at 06:21:58PM -0600, Jim Fehlig wrote:
>> On 03/23/2016 09:27 AM, osstest service owner wrote:
>>> flight 87014 ovmf real [real]
>>> http://logs.test-lab.xenproject.org/osstest/logs/87014/
>>>
>>> Regressions :-(
>>>
>>> Tests which did not succeed and are blocking,
>>> including tests which could not be run:
>>> test-amd64-amd64-xl-qemuu-ovmf-amd64 9 debian-hvm-install fail REGR. vs. 65543
>>> test-amd64-i386-xl-qemuu-ovmf-amd64 9 debian-hvm-install fail REGR. vs. 65543
>> I've been testing Anthony's series to 'Load BIOS via toolstack instead of been
>> embedded in hvmloader' [0] in an attempt to use the distro ovmf instead of
>> "ovmf-xen". openSUSE Factory's ovmf package [1] is updated regularly with an
>> upstream git snapshot and I noticed VMs did not boot when using it. I bisected
>> and found ovmf commit 7b0a1ead the culprit
>>
>> commit 7b0a1ead7d2efa7f9eae4c2b254ff154d9c5f74f
>> Author: Ruiyu Ni <ruiyu.ni@intel.com>
>> Date: Wed Feb 17 18:06:36 2016 +0800
>>
>> MdeModuelPkg/PciBus: Return AddrTranslationOffset in GetBarAttributes
>>
>> Some platform doesn't use CPU(HOST)/Device 1:1 mapping for PCI Bus.
>> But PCI IO doesn't have interface to tell caller (device driver)
>> whether the address returned by GetBarAttributes() is HOST address
>> or device address.
>> UEFI Spec 2.6 addresses this issue by clarifying the address returned
>> is HOST address and caller can use AddrTranslationOffset to calculate
>> the device address.
>>
>> I'm sure it's biting this test too.
>
> Yes, and OSSTest already fingered that commit. According to Anthony OVMF
> is even more broken now because more bugs crept in.
>
> Anthony is working on fixing OVMF.
Cool. Thanks Anthony!
>
>> BTW, any pointers on getting debug info from
>> hvmloader+ovmf+qemu+other-components-involved? With the broken ovmf, I got
>> nothing on the VM serial port, an empty, black vfb, nothing beyond "Invoking
>> OVMF..." in xl dmesg, and no errors in the qemu log file. Beyond bisecting, I
>> wasn't sure how to debug :-). I tried adding
>>
>> device_model_args=[ "-debugcon file:debug.log", "-global isa-debugcon.iobase=0x402"]
>>
>
> Can you try
>
> device_model_args = ["-debugcon", "file:debug.log", "-global", "isa-debugcon.iobase=0x402"]
Yes, that worked. Thanks.
Regards,
Jim
_______________________________________________
Xen-devel mailing list
Xen-devel@lists.xen.org
http://lists.xen.org/xen-devel
^ permalink raw reply [flat|nested] 4+ messages in thread
end of thread, other threads:[~2016-03-24 16:38 UTC | newest]
Thread overview: 4+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2016-03-23 15:27 [ovmf test] 87014: regressions - FAIL osstest service owner
2016-03-24 0:21 ` Jim Fehlig
2016-03-24 14:12 ` Wei Liu
2016-03-24 16:38 ` Jim Fehlig
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).